There is no age limit as such for hair removal. Yet, it is always advised never to try various hair removal methods on youngsters. Though there is no age limit for performing hair removal treatments, surgeons always recommend this after the age of 17. There are some specific reasons for this. One main reason why teenagers are not allowed to undergo hair removal treatments is that their hair growth system might not be fully developed. As a result, there could be severe side effects or negative results.

In laser hair removal, the laser will remove the present hair in the body but often it fails to prevent the hair system from growing again. If you are looking for long lasting results, it is always better to allow the hair to grow fully. When the hair system has grown effectively, you could try for methods which go well with your skin and body type. You will be able to enjoy full benefits after this.
